> > I've two questions, they may or may not be related -
> > 1. I copied the entire data directory [including
> > postgresql.conf, base, ...] from postgreSQL 7.3.2 (AIX4.3)
> > to the installation postgreSQL 7.3.4 (AIX5.1), the same filesystem
> > setup. I didn't do an dump/reload process
> > since the copy process is faster.
> >
> > Is it OK to take this shortcut in postgreSQL? any side-effects?
> >
>
> If you did this while PG was running you have a big pile of meaningless
> data.  The only two ways to do this are to shut down PG and copy or use
> an LVM and take a snapshot.
